Moving from Columbus to San Francisco

Moving from Columbus, Ohio to San Francisco, California covers approximately 2,108 miles, classifying this as an interstate move. Pricing depends on factors like the size of your household goods, the level of service chosen, and timing. This long-distance route requires coordination for transport and delivery, with typical delivery times ranging from three to four days.

How much does it cost to move from Columbus to San Francisco?

Expect moving costs from Columbus to San Francisco to vary based on the size of your move. Small moves typically range from $1,765 to $1,870, medium moves from $2,030 to $2,150, and large moves from $2,294 to $2,431.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Planning ahead and comparing quotes can help manage your budget effectively.

Answers to popular questions about moving from Columbus to San Francisco

Here are common questions about moving from Columbus, Ohio to San Francisco, California to help you prepare and plan your move.

How much does it typically cost to move from Columbus to San Francisco?

Moving costs vary by the size of your move. Small moves range from $1,765 to $1,870, medium moves from $2,030 to $2,150, and large moves from $2,294 to $2,431. Additional services and timing can affect these estimates.

What is the expected delivery timeline for a move between Columbus and San Francisco?

Standard delivery usually takes about 4 days, while expedited options can reduce this to 3 days. Delivery times depend on the moving company’s schedule and route logistics.

What is the cheapest moving option for this route?

The most affordable option is typically a self-service move or a small load shipment. Full-service moves with packing and storage will cost more but offer greater convenience.

When should I book my move to get the best rates?

Booking several weeks in advance can secure better pricing and availability. Avoid peak moving seasons like summer to reduce costs.

Are movers from Columbus to San Francisco required to have interstate licenses?

Yes, moving companies operating across state lines must be licensed by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to ensure compliance and protection.

What logistics are involved in a long-distance move from Ohio to California?

Long-distance moves require careful planning for transport routes, timing, and coordination of loading and unloading. Additional services like storage or packing may be needed depending on your schedule.
